A beautifully proportioned family home with no upward chain, ideally positioned in the sought-after Bramcote area of Nottingham
This spacious and versatile property offers well-balanced accommodation across two floors, perfectly suited to modern family living. The ground floor welcomes you with a generous entrance hall leading through to a bright and expansive living room featuring a bay window, creating an inviting space for relaxation and entertaining. A separate dining room flows into the conservatory, providing a lovely outlook onto the garden.
The well-appointed kitchen/breakfast room is complemented by a useful utility room and ground floor WC, adding everyday practicality.
To the first floor, the property boasts four well-proportioned bedrooms, including a master bedroom with en-suite facilities, alongside a family bathroom and spacious landing that enhances the feeling of light and space throughout.
Externally, the home benefits from a detached double garage and ample storage potential, with the added advantage of solar panels, offering energy efficiency and potential savings on electricity bills, ideal for environmentally conscious homeowners. The rear garden is fully enclosed and enjoys a bright, sunny aspect, creating a secure and inviting outdoor space. Perfect for children and pets, it offers an ideal setting for play, relaxation, and outdoor entertaining throughout the day.
The property is conveniently close to a wide range of local amenities, excellent transport links, and well-regarded schools. The stunning Wollaton Deer Park is just a short distance away, offering beautiful open spaces, historic surroundings, and leisure opportunities right on your doorstep.
